President Bola Tinubu appointed Rear Admiral Emmanuel I. Ogalla as the 24th Chief of Naval Staff (CNS) on Monday night.
Vice Admiral Auwal Zubairu Gambo, the 23rd CNS, succeeds him.
Rear Admiral Ogalla, from Enugu State, is a member of the Nigeria Defence Academy’s (NDA) 39 Regular Course.
After the 12th CNS – Rear Admiral – he is the second Igbo-born Chief of Naval Staff.
Allison Amaechina Madueke, a native of Enugu State like Ogalla, served in that role from November 1993 until August 1994.
Rear Admiral Ogalla previously served as the Director of Lessons Learned at NHQ (PPLANS).
According to Naval Headquarters, he was named Director Lessons Learned on January 2, 2022.
Director Audit on 17/03/2021; DPR on 08/04/2019; Directing Staff at the National Defence College (NDC) on 16/01/2017; Deputy Director Hydrography at the Naval Headquarters on 28/03/2016; and Commandant, Hydrography School on 29/08/2014 were his previous assignments.
On 03/11/2014, the senior officer completed the Post NDC MSc Programme at the University of Ibadan, and on 05/09/2013, he completed NDC Course 22.

He was appointed BOO on 20/08/2009; SOII SURVEY 24/07/06 at the Hydro office; he attended the Armed Forces Command and Staff College Jaji, Kaduna State, Senior Course 28 on 03/08/05.
GSS, DSS, MSS, FSS, psc fdc, BSc Maths were all awarded to Real Admiral Ogalla.
